« RaXino-iの出荷開始と、3つのメリット | トップページ | ET2012に出展します »

2012.11.05

大画面Android FT103が文鎮化した でもあきらめない

先日購入した21インチ大画面Androidタブレット「FT103」が先週の金曜日から文鎮化してしまっていたようです。文鎮というには大きすぎる。パネルがテカテカなので鏡台化とでも言ったほうがいいかもしれません。

Ft103bunchin

上のログインの画面までは行くのですが、そこからログインをするには何をやるにしても、重過ぎるのです。指で画面をタッチすると、タッチが認識されるまでに20秒くらいかかります。

つまり何か裏ですごく重いものが走り続けている感じなのです。

このFT103を使っていた特電スタッフによれば、パソコンからADB(Android Debug Bridge)を経由で操作しようとしてもだめだったとのこと。来週のET2012デモ用に使おうと思っていたので、この時期に壊れるのはとても痛いです。

そんなとき、ふと思い出しました。RXマイコンでADBを作って、ADBシェルをUSB仮想COMポート経由で叩けるようにしたアプリがあったことを。

さっそくやってみました。2つあるUSBの片方をUSBホストにしてAndroidにつなぎ、もう片方を仮想COMポートにしてパソコンにつなぎます。次の写真がその様子です。

Rxadb2

まず、RXマイコンでADBプログラムを起動しておいてから、FT103の電源を入れます。USBが動き出すとRXマイコンがADBの接続を認識するので、すかさずlogcatと打ってみます。

Ft103logcat

おおおっ、なにやらlogcatが動き出したですぞ。ログイン画面で固まったとき、ADBのシェルでtopと打ってみると・・

root@android:/ # top

User 1%, System 21%, IOW 0%, IRQ 0%
User 11 + Nice 0 + Sys 134 + Idle 465 + IOW 0 + IRQ 0 + SIRQ 0 = 610

  PID PR CPU% S  #THR     VSS     RSS PCY UID      Name
  324  0  10% D     1      0K      0K  fg root     kworker/u:5
 1294  0  10% D     1      0K      0K  fg root     kworker/u:3
  184  1   4% S    67 547816K  63624K  fg system   system_server
 1342  1   1% R     1   1004K    408K  fg root     top
   73  0   0% S     1      0K      0K  fg root     kworker/u:4
 1253  0   0% S     9 458424K  56480K  fg system   com.android.systemui
 1337  0   0% S     1      0K      0K  fg root     kworker/0:0
    9  1   0% S     1      0K      0K  fg root     ksoftirqd/1
   11  1   0% S     1      0K      0K  fg root     suspend
   12  0   0% S     1      0K      0K  fg root     sync_supers
   13  1   0% S     1      0K      0K  fg root     bdi-default
   14  1   0% S     1      0K      0K  fg root     kblockd
   15  1   0% S     1      0K      0K  fg root     omap2_mcspi
   16  0   0% S     1      0K      0K  fg root     khubd
   17  0   0% S     1      0K      0K  fg root     twl6030-irq
   18  1   0% S     1      0K      0K  fg root     irq/372-twl6030
   19  1   0% S     1      0K      0K  fg root     irq/378-twl6030
   20  1   0% S     1      0K      0K  fg root     musb-otg
   22  1   0% S     1      0K      0K  fg root     kinteractiveup

どうやらkworkerというのが2つ動いていて、これが常にCPUのパワーを食っている様子です。kworkerって何だろう。

そういえばプロンプトに「root@android:/ #」と出ている。誰か特電のスタッフが既にFT103のrootを取っていた模様。あぶないな~。なんでroot取ってるんだ?そういえばフォントを変えたいとか言ってたから、それかな。

GUI画面からどうにも操作できなくなったAndroid機だけど、ADBシェルからなら何とかなるかもしれません。続きはまた明日。

|

« RaXino-iの出荷開始と、3つのメリット | トップページ | ET2012に出展します »

コメント

初めまして、私も文鎮化しそうだったのでこのページ行きつきました。
で、ここの現象見て、GUIは動かないけど、自分もRoot取れてることに気づいて、
RootとれるScriptを参考に以下のコマンドを叩けば治りましたのでご報告します。

#suを転送します。
adb push su /system/bin/su
#Ownerを変更
adb shell
chown root.shell /system/bin/su
chmod 06755 /system/bin/su
#確認します
ls -l /system/bin/su
-rwsr-sr-x 3565 shell 22364 2013-01-24 22:28 su

#上記ならば、
rm /data/local.prop
#で疑似rootファイルを消して
reboot
#これでGUIもrootも取れてました。
#ちなみにうちはFT103-V2です。

投稿: K.MAD | 2013.01.24 23:37

コメントを書く



(ウェブ上には掲載しません)




« RaXino-iの出荷開始と、3つのメリット | トップページ | ET2012に出展します »